| Application: | N-Boc-p-phenylenediamine can be used as: • A reactant to prepare perylene monoimide-based dyes for dye-sensitized solar cell applications. • A starting material to synthesize covalent organic frameworks, which are used as proton exchange membranes for hydrogen fuel cell applications. • A reactant in the synthesis of bestatin derived hydroxamic acids as potent pan-HDAC inhibitors. |
| Other Notes: | Mono-N-acylated diamine, precursor of different Para-substituted anilines (e.g., 4-azido aniline); Synthesis of photoactivable derivative of ouabaine. |
